What is Premature Ejaculation?
Premature ejaculation usually refers to the condition when ejaculation happens sooner than wanted, either before penetration or shortly after it, resulting in distress for one or both partners. Early ejaculation sometimes occurs but may be normal. Causes of Premature Ejaculation in Young Men
Typically, the ability in young men has both psychological and physical aspects. The commonest causes include :
- Performance anxiety and stress in new relations
- Depressed or emotional pressures that link to work or personal life
- Hormonal imbalance- abnormal serotonin, testosterone levels
- Hypersensitivity of nerves leading to reduced control over ejaculation
- General lifestyles, for example ; poor sleep, smoking, alcohol use, or lack of exercise
A good understanding of the cause is vital because it helps doctors select the best method of male premature ejaculation treatment.
Symptoms to Observe for Premature Ejaculation
Symptoms of premature ejaculation:
- Ejaculation occurs within one minute after penetration.
- Inability to delay ejaculation in most sexual encounters.
- Someone feeling frustration, embarrassment, or avoidance to having coveted intimacy.

Treatments Available for Male Premature Ejaculation
Modern medical science provides great treatment options. At a specialized clinic for premature ejaculation, treatment is generally individualized. It can involve the following:
Prescription for drugs to modulate profiles of neurotransmitters concerned with ejaculation
- External treatment by topical therapies to abate penile hypersensitivity
- Using behavioral techniques like the start-stop or squeeze methods
- Counselling or sex therapy on the issues of any anxiety or psychological roots

Prevention Tips for Long-Term Control
While treatment is one aspect, prevention certainly plays a big part in the long-term management of premature ejaculation. Most of the following will apply to young men:
- Stress management through exercise, meditation, or therapy
- Eat well and exercise regularly for healthy living
- Avoid smoking, excessive alcohol, and other recreational drugs
- Explore putting all expectations aside and openly communicating with each other to decrease performance pressure
